Most common Hyundai Accent gl MOT faults

These are the faults and advisories recorded most often across Hyundai Accent gl MOT tests:

  1. Nearside Front Tyre worn close to the legal limit (4.1.E.1) (22 times)
  2. Offside Front Tyre worn close to the legal limit (4.1.E.1) (16 times)
  3. Nearside Rear Tyre worn close to the legal limit (4.1.E.1) (14 times)
  4. Nearside Front position lamp(s) not working (1.1.A.3b) (8 times)
  5. Child seat fitted not allowing full inspection of adult belt (8 times)
  6. Front Brake pad(s) wearing thin (3.5.1g) (7 times)
  7. Parking brake: efficiency below requirements (3.7.B.7) (7 times)
  8. Windscreen has damage to an area less than a 10mm circle within zone 'A' (8.3.1a) (7 times)
  9. Nearside Front Brake pipe excessively corroded (3.6.B.2c) (6 times)
  10. Parking brake lever has no reserve travel (3.1.6b) (6 times)
  11. Nearside Rear Brake pipe excessively corroded (3.6.B.2c) (6 times)
  12. Nearside Front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ively (8.2.2) (6 times)
  13. Nearside Front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m (4.1.E.1) (6 times)
  14. Nearside Front Anti-roll bar linkage insecure (2.4.G.1) (5 times)
  15. Oil leak (5 times)
